#04ff5c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#04ff5c is composed of 1.6% red, 100% green and 36.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 98.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 63.9%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 141 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 50.8%. #04ff5c color hex could be obtained by blending #08ffb8 with #00ff00. Closest websafe color is: #00ff66.

Shades and Tints of #04ff5c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000401 is the darkest color, while #effff5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#04ff5c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#788b7f is the less saturated color, while #04ff5c is the most saturated one.
